Some of the modular lenses that are known to be used on the ISS include several Nikon F and 15 Nikon Z lenses, for cameras such as the D4 and Z9. [21] [13] This includes the Nikon 24-70mm f/2.8E ED VR, the Nikkor 600mm f/4G AF-S VR ED, [22] the Nikon 800mm f/5.6E FL ED VR, and the Nikon AF-S FX TC-14E III 1.4x Teleconverter.

On the International Space Station (ISS), extravehicular activities are major events in the building and maintaining of the orbital laboratory, [1] and are performed to install new components, re-wire systems, modules, and equipment, and to monitor, install, and retrieve scientific experiments.

The Int-Ball, also known as the JEM Internal Ball Camera, is a series of experimental, autonomous, self-propelled, and maneuverable ball cameras, deployed in the Japanese KibÅ module of the International Space Station. The devices are intended to perform some of the photo-video documentation tasks aboard the ISS, reducing the workload of the ...

Atmosphere-Space Interactions Monitor (ASIM) is a project led by the European Space Agency to place cameras and X-ray/γ-ray detectors on the International Space Station to observe the upper atmosphere in order to study sprites, jets and elves and terrestrial gamma-ray flashes in connection with thunderstorms. The process of assembling the International Space Station (ISS) has been under way since the 1990s. Zarya , the first ISS module, was launched by a Proton rocket on 20 November 1998. The STS-88 Space Shuttle mission followed two weeks after Zarya was launched, bringing Unity , the first of three node modules, and connecting it to Zarya .
